puppeteer-har-with-pw

1.2.0 • Public • Published

puppeteer-har

npm version

Generate HAR file with puppeteer.

Install

npm install puppeteer-har

Usage

const puppeteer = require('puppeteer');
const PuppeteerHar = require('puppeteer-har');
 
(async () => {
  const browser = await puppeteer.launch();
  const page = await browser.newPage();
 
  const har = new PuppeteerHar(page);
  await har.start({ path: 'results.har' });
 
  await page.goto('http://example.com');
 
  await har.stop();
  await browser.close();
})();

PuppeteerHar(page)

har.start([options])

  • options <?Object> Optional
    • path <string> If set HAR file will be written at this path
  • returns: <Promise>

har.stop()

  • returns: <Promise<?Object>> If path is not set in har.start Promise will return object with HAR.

Versions

Current Tags

  • Version
    Downloads (Last 7 Days)
    • Tag
  • 1.2.0
    1
    • latest

Version History

  • Version
    Downloads (Last 7 Days)
    • Published
  • 1.2.0
    1

Package Sidebar

Install

npm i puppeteer-har-with-pw

Weekly Downloads

1

Version

1.2.0

License

MIT

Unpacked Size

10.7 kB

Total Files

6

Last publish

Collaborators

  • maciejmaciejewski